I own a youth basketball program and would like to implement a "Schedule Builder" and registration process for my website. I need someone to map this all out and develop the logic for the various type of scheduling for games, leagues and tournaments. If you aren't familiar with sports (especially basketball) please do not apply.
Brief overview (I will give more details to competent bidders)
Registration Process:
- Coaches will register and receive permanent ID
- Players will register and receive permanent ID
- Coaches can create a Team, using Player ID #'s to build their roster
- When a coach adds a Player, the player can accept or deny invitation then must pay for the registration of event.
- Admin will be able to see all Coaches, all Players, their status (registered, approved, etc).
Scheduling Process:
I will have people working with me that will build leagues, tournaments (double / single elimination) and based on the information they provide in initial steps the background logic will create a bracket for them to post online. From there they can select the winner of each game and the bracket will automatically update based on the results.
I wiill also have a statistics form in which coaches can submit the Player ID # and their statistics and it will update the Players permanent records with tournament name, game outcome and stats.
This is a long term, very in-depth project that will require much dialog and detail. Please submit any similar work done, your qualifications and any applicable samples. So that I know you read this in full, also submit your timezone.
Thank you.